How do you write 948 in Roman Numerals?

The Arabic number 948 in roman numerals is CMXLVIII.

That is, if you want to write the digit 948 using roman symbols, you must use the symbol or symbols CMXLVIII, since these roman numerals are exactly equivalent to the arabic numeral Nine hundred fourty eight.

CMXLVIII = 948
